شائع ہوا: 2024-02-19

پرائم نمبر سوڈوکو ویریئنٹس کی تخلیق: ریاضیاتی پیورز کا رہنما

کائناتی خلا میں ریاضیاتی ہم آہنگی کی علامت کے طور پر روشنی گیندیں

معیاری 9x9 سودوکو گرڈز نوں ایسٹ مختلف علامتوں پر انحصار کرتے ہیں، جو قطار، کالم اور علاقے میں بالکل ایک بار آتی ہیں۔ ابتدائی اعداد (پرائم نمبرز) کا تعارف دلاتے ہوئے—جو حساب کے بنیادی بلاکس ہیں—ہم ایسے لاجک پزلز بنا سکتے ہیں جو عددیات کو کلاسیک گرڈ شرائط کے ساتھ ملاتے ہیں۔ ابتدائی اعداد پر مبنی ویریئنٹس ڈیزائن کرنے کے لیے ہندسوں کی تقسیم، امیدواروں کی کثافت اور پابندیوں کی پروپیگیشن کا احتیاط سے خیال رکھنا ضروری ہے۔

ریاضیاتی بنیاد: ابتدائی اعداد کیوں؟

ابتدائی اعداد استعمال کرتے ہوئے موثر پزلز ڈیزائن کرنے کے لیے، ہمیں پہلے ان ریاضیاتی خصوصیات کو سمجھنا ہوگا جو وہ متعارف کراتی ہیں۔ معیاری سودوکو میں، منفرد ہونا آسان ہے: ہر علامت ایک اکائی میں بالکل ایک بار ظاہر ہوتی ہے۔ ابتدائی اعداد پر مبنی ویریئنٹ میں، ڈیزائنرز اکثر مخصوص نمبر سیٹس کے ساتھ کام کرتے ہیں، جیسے کہ چھوٹے گرڈز کے لیے {2, 3, 5, 7} یا توسیع شدہ فارمیٹس کے لیے بڑے سیٹ۔ ڈیزائن کا فلسفہ سادہ پیٹرن کی پوزیشن سے ہٹ کر ابتدائی امیدواروں کی منفرد رویے کو منظم کرنے کی طرف منتقل ہو جاتا ہے۔

ایک عام نقطۂ آغاز صرف ابتدائی اعداد کو ڈیجٹ سیٹ میں محدود کرنا ہے۔ معیاری 9x9 گرڈ کے لیے، {2, 3, 5, 7} کا استعمال اس کا مطلب ہے کہ قطاروں اور کالموں میں ہندسوں کی تکرار ہوگی، جو منطقی استنتاج کے راستے کو برقرار رکھنے کے لیے علاقوں یا اپنا بلок شیپس پر سخت پابندیوں پر زور دیتا ہے۔ اس تکرار کی ضرورت روایتی پزلز کے مقابلے میں حل کرنے کے انداز کو بدل دیتی ہے۔

بڑے گرڈز، جیسے کہ 16x16، ابتدائی اعداد پر مبنی سیٹس کے لیے زیادہ لچک پیش کرتے ہیں۔ ڈیزائنرز گرڈ کے سائز کے ساتھ فٹ ہونے والے کوئی بھی مختلف ابتدائی اعداد کی رینج منتخب کر سکتے ہیں، جس سے حل کرنے والے کو مغلوب کیے بغیر امیدواروں کی کثافت بڑھائی جا سکتی ہے۔ چیلنج کا مرکز عددی تعلقات کو منظم کرنے اور یہ یقینی بنانے کی طرف منتقل ہو جاتا ہے کہ دیے گئے clues واضح منطقی راستے پیدا کریں، عشروی رکاوٹوں کے بجائے۔

تخلیقی پابندیاتی میکانزم

ابتدائی اعداد پر مبنی ویریئنٹس کی قدر اس میں ہے کہ عددی خصوصیات کو ساختی پابندیوں کے طور پر کیسے استعمال کیا جا سکتا ہے۔ چونکہ ابتدائی اعداد کے بالکل دو تقسیم کنندہ ہوتے ہیں، یہ مرکب اعداد کے مقابلے میں ریاضیاتی قواعد کے ساتھ مختلف طریقے سے تعامل کرتے ہیں، جو مخصوص ڈیزائن ٹیکنیکس کو ممکن بناتے ہیں۔

  • جوڑے دار ابتدائی اعداد اور جوارشری قواعد: ڈیزائنرز ابتدائی اعداد کے خلاؤں پر مبنی پابندیاں نافذ کر سکتے ہیں۔ مثال کے طور پر، ایک ویریئنٹ پڑوسی خالی خانوں میں جوڑے دار ابتدائی اعداد (جوڑے جس کا فرق 2 ہو، جیسے 3 اور 5، یا 11 اور 13) رکھنے کی اجازت نہیں دیتا۔ یہ معیاری سودوکو کے پلیسمنٹ قواعد کے ساتھ مماثلت پیدا کرنے والا ایک غیر ملحقہ تہہ شامل کرتا ہے۔
  • زوجیت کا انتظام: 2 کے علاوہ، تمام ابتدائی اعداد طاق ہیں۔ یہ نمبر 2 کو ایک منفرد زوجیت کے outlier بناتا ہے۔ پزلز ایسے تعمیر کیے جا سکتے ہیں جہاں 2 کو مخصوص پلیسمنٹ پیٹرنز کی پیروی کرنی ہوگی، یا قطاریں جو اس میں شامل ہیں علاقائی قواعد کو تبدیل کر دیتی ہیں، بغیر حسابی پیچیدگی کے ساختی تنوع پیدا کرتے ہوئے۔
  • پروڈکٹ پر مبنی قفس: ان ویریئنٹس میں جو ریاضیاتی آپریشنز استعمال کرتے ہیں، ابتدائی اعداد والی پروڈکٹ قفس منفرد تجزیہ خصوصیات کو ظاہر کرتے ہیں۔ حل کرنے والوں کو یہ طے کرنا ہوگا کہ کیا پروڈکٹ ابتدائی ہے، سیمی پرائم ہے، یا مرکب، جس سے گریڈ لاجک کے ساتھ ساتھ تجزیہ کی مہارتیں بھی فروغ پاتی ہیں۔

اگر آپ ان پزلز میں دلچسپی رکھتے ہیں جو ریاضیاتی آپریشنز کے ذریعے ہندسوں کو ملا کر بنائے جاتے ہیں، تو آپ کیلکڈوکو کا بھی مطالعہ کر سکتے ہیں، جس کی ساختی مماثلتیں ریاضی سے مرکزیت والے ویریئنٹس کے ساتھ ہیں لیکن عام طور پر معیاری ہندسوں کے سیٹس استعمال کرتا ہے۔

گرڈ کا ڈھانچہ اور بلاک ڈیزائن

معیاری ہندسوں کے سیٹس سے ہٹتے ہوئے، روایتی 3x3 بلاک ڈھانچے میں اکثر ایڈجسٹمنٹ کی ضرورت ہوتی ہے۔ بڑے ابتدائی اعداد پر مبنی گرڈز کے لیے، منطق اور بہاؤ کو برقرار رکھنے کے علاقائی جیومیٹری کو دوبارہ سوچنا ضروری ہے۔

غیر یقینی علاقے: یکساں مربعوں کے بجائے، ڈیزائنرز گرڈ کے سائز سے مطابقت رکھنے والے پولیومینو شکلوں کا استعمال کر سکتے ہیں۔ ان علاقوں کو خاص عددی جوڑوں کے درمیان تعامل پر زور دینے کے لیے تیار کیا جانا چاہیے۔ مثال کے طور پر، یہ یقینی بنانا کہ کوئی بھی علاقہ دو ایسے ابتدائی اعداد نہیں رکھتا جو ایک مکمل مربع کا مجموعہ بنتے ہیں، حل کرنے کے عمل کے دوران قدرتی استنتاج کے نقاط پیدا کرتا ہے۔

متبادل ٹوپالوجیاں: ہیکساگنل یا دیگر غیر کارٹیشین گرڈز پر پابندیاں لاگو کرنا جوارشری قواعد اور علاقے کی لے آؤٹس کو بالکل تبدیل کر دیتا ہے۔ یہ ساختی تنوع ان حل کرنے والوں کو اپیل کرتا ہے جو بینری لاجک پزلز کی قدر کرتے ہیں، جو عددی حساب کتاب پر انحصار کے بجائے سخت مقامی تعلقات پر توجہ دیتے ہیں، عددی وزن والے ویریئنٹس کے مقابلے ایک متضاد نقطہ نظر پیش کرتے ہیں۔

غیر یقینیت سے بچنا اور حل پذیریت کو یقینی بنانا

ابتدائی اعداد پر مبنی سودوکو ڈیزائن کرنے میں سب سے بڑا چیلنج متعدد حل سے بچنا ہے۔ جب ہندسوں کے سیٹ محدود یا غیر مسلسل ہوتے ہیں، تو معیاری حل الگورتھمز کو سختی سے لاگو کرنا ضروری ہے۔

  1. تقسیم کا تجزیہ: تصدیق کریں کہ ہر منتخب شدہ ابتدائی عدد گرڈ میں مناسب تعدد کے ساتھ ظاہر ہوتا ہے۔ غیر مساوی انکشاف اکثر مجبور حدس کی طرف لے جاتا ہے بجائے منطقی استنتاج کے۔
  2. منفرد نمونے: معیاری اموات کے نمونے، جیسے منفرد مستطیل، اپنی مرضی کے ہندسوں کے سیٹس کے ساتھ اب بھی وقوع پذیر ہو سکتے ہیں۔ یہ یقینی بنائیں کہ دیے گئے clues کسی بھی ممکنہ متوازی لوپ کو توڑیں جہاں علامتیں قواعد کی خلاف ورزی کے بغیر آپس میں تبدیل ہو سکتی ہیں۔
  3. پابندی کی پروپیگیشن: حل کی تصدیق کا استعمال کریں تاکہ یقینی بنایا جا سکے کہ ہر clue استنتاج کی واضح زنجیر کو متحرک کرتا ہے۔ ابتدائی اعداد کے خلاؤں یا علاقوں کے اوورلیپ سے قدرتی طور پر پیدا ہونے والی مجبور جگہوں کی تلاش کریں۔ دیے گئے clues کو لاجک کے ان لمحات کو زیادہ سے زیادہ کرنے کے لیے ڈیزائن کریں، بجائے اس کے کہ پراسرار حسابی ٹرکس پر انحصار کیا جائے۔

اگر آپ اعلیٰ ریاضیاتی پابندیوں کے تجربے سے پہلے بنیادی پلیسمنٹ منطق کو مضبوط کرنے کی تلاش میں ہیں، تو کچھ شروع کنندگان کے لیے دوستانہ سودوکو پر مشق کرنے سے پیٹرن کی پہچان اور ختم کرنے کی تکنیکوں کو بہتر بنانے میں مدد مل سکتی ہے۔

نظریاتی ویریئنٹس اور ساختی تجربات

ڈیزائنرز کے لیے جو عددیات کے تقاطع کا گرڈ لاجک کے ساتھ تلاش کر رہے ہیں، ابتدائی اعداد کی پابندیاں چند نظریاتی فریم ورکس پیش کرتی ہیں۔

محدود ابتدائی اعداد کے سیٹ: خاص ذیلی سیٹس کا استعمال جیسے مرسین ابتدائی اعداد (شکل $2^p - 1$ کے ابتدائی اعداد، جیسے 3, 7, 31) دستیاب علامتوں کو نمایاں طور پر کم کر دیتا ہے۔ یہ طریقہ بڑے گرڈز یا تبدیل شدہ قواعد کے ساتھ بہترین کام کرتا ہے، کیونکہ یہ علاقائی تعاملات اور اعلیٰ ختم کرنے کی تکنیکوں پر بھاری انحصار کو مجبور کرتا ہے۔

مجموعے پر مبنی ابتدائی اعداد کے قواعد: بعض ڈیزائنز میٹا پابندیاں شامل کرتے ہیں جہاں مخصوص قطاریں یا کالم ہدف کے عدد کی تعداد میں ابتدائی اعداد رکھتے ہیں جو مجموعی طور پر ایک ابتدائی کل تک پہنچتے ہیں۔ یہ بنیادی پلیسمنٹ میکانکس کو پیچیدہ کیے بغیر ایک تصدیقی تہہ شامل کرتا ہے۔

قفس پروڈکٹ پابندیاں: گرڈ لاجک کو صرف ابتدائی اعداد والی قفس کے ساتھ جوڑنا سخت منطقی سرحدیں پیدا کرتا ہے۔ ایک ایسا قفس جس کی پروڈکٹ ابتدائی ہے، صرف ایک ابتدائی اور ونز رکھ سکتا ہے، یا بالکل دو ابتدائی اگر سائز اس کے مطابق ہو۔ یہ کِلر سودوکو کے ساتھ ایک واضح تضاد پیدا کرتا ہے، جہاں مجموعے کی لچک معیاری ہے، فیکٹرائزیشن کو بنیادی حل کا آلہ بنا کر۔

آپ کے ڈیزائن کی جانچ اور بہتری

کسی بھی عددی ویریئنٹ کے لیے سخت جانچ ضروری ہے۔ معیاری سودوکو کے برعکس، جو معروف ہندسوں کے نمونوں پر انحصار کرتا ہے، ابتدائی اعداد کے ویریئنٹس کو حل کرنے والوں سے عددی خصوصیات کا مقامی منطق کے ساتھ جائزہ لینے کی ضرورت ہوتی ہے۔

  • مشقت کی کیلیبریشن: پزلز کو حسابی پیچیدگی کے بجائے درکار منطقی گہرائی کے مطابق مرتب کریں۔ بنیادی ختم کرنا اعلیٰ علاقائی تعاملات سے پہلے ہونا چاہیے۔
  • بصری توازن: چھوٹے نمبروں کی طرف بصری جانبداری سے بچنے کے لیے ابتدائی اعداد کو دیے گئے میں یکساں طور پر تقسیم کریں۔ ایک متوازن لے آؤٹ عددی لائن کے ساتھ ابتدائی اعداد کی قدرتی تقسیم کا عکاس ہوتا ہے۔
  • پائلٹ ٹیسٹنگ: منطقی پزل کے شوقینوں کے ساتھ مسودے بانٹیں جو ریاضیاتی پابندیوں سے لطف اندوز ہوتے ہیں۔ ان کی فیڈبیک غیر یقینیت یا ضرورت سے زیادہ حسابی انحصار کو ظاہر کر سکتا ہے جسے ایک صاف حل کرنے کے تجربے کے لیے بہتر بنایا جا سکتا ہے۔

نتیجہ

ابتدائی اعداد پر مرکوز سودوکو ویریئنٹس ڈیزائن کرنا پابندی کی منتقلی اور منطق کے ڈھانچے کا عملی مشق ہے۔ غیر تقسیم پذیری، زوجیت اور کثافت جیسے خصوصیات کو استعمال کرتے ہوئے، ڈیزائنرز ایسے پزلز بنا سکتے ہیں جو پیچیدہ حساب سے بالاتر عددی تعلقات کے ذریعے حل کرنے والوں کو چیلنج کریں۔ علاقائی شکلوں میں تبدیل کرنا، امیدواروں کے سیٹس کو ایڈجسٹ کرنا، یا پروڈکٹ پر مبنی قواعد کی تہیں لگانا، ترجیح منطق کی سالمیت اور واضح استنتاج کے راستے ہی رہتی ہے۔

ان فریم ورکس کے ساتھ تجربہ کرتے وقت، وضاحت اور ساختی خوبصورتی پر توجہ دیں۔ اچھی طرح سے جانچے گئے ابتدائی اعداد پر مبنی ویریئنٹس روایتی گرڈز کے لیے ایک تازگی بخش متبادل پیش کر سکتے ہیں، حل کرنے والوں کے لیے منطق کے پزل میکانکس کے ساتھ ریاضیاتی استدلال کو پسند کرنے والوں کے لیے ایک منظم راستہ فراہم کرتے ہوئے۔

Play Qoki on mobile

Prefer to play offline? Get the app.